#469fe2 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#469fe2 is composed of 27.5% red, 62.4% green and 88.6%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 69% cyan, 29.6% magenta, 0% yellow and 11.4% black. It has a hue angle of 205.8 degrees, a saturation of 72.9% and a lightness of 58%. #469fe2 color hex could be obtained by blending #8cffff with #003fc5. Closest websafe color is: #3399cc.

Shades and Tints of #469fe2
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#000102 is the darkest color, while #f0f7fd is the lightest one.

Tones of #469fe2
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#909598 is the less saturated color, while #2da2fb is the most saturated one.
